Tech That Feels Like Magic

Hop on an iQube, and it’s like stepping into tomorrow’s commute today. The ST variant boasts a 7-inch TFT touchscreen that’s not just pretty—it’s your personal cockpit with customizable themes, voice assist, and even Alexa integration for hands-free commands. Geofencing keeps your ride secure, while OTA updates ensure you’re always ahead of the curve.

Base models shine too, with a 5-inch TFT offering turn-by-turn navigation and SmartXonnect app perks like remote diagnostics and crash alerts.

Recent tricks include smartwatch connectivity via Noise partnership, letting you glance at battery status or tire pressure without pulling over.

Add 32 liters of under-seat storage, USB ports, and reverse parking assist, and it’s clear TVS packed smarts into every corner.

Design and Ride That Turns Heads

Glide through Delhi’s dusty streets or Mumbai’s monsoons, and the iQube feels planted. Its underbone frame balances agility with stability, hitting urban speeds effortlessly while sipping power for real-world ranges that deliver on promises.

The ST Concept from Auto Expo 2025 stole the show with a turquoise aurora borealis paint job, quilted seats, and a promise of even longer hauls beyond the current 212 km IDC claim.

Newer variants like the 3.1 kWh pack bridge gaps for shorter trips, while full LED lights and TPMS on top trims add that premium touch.

Riders rave about the smooth torque, confident braking, and whisper-quiet vibes that make petrol scooters feel dated. In a sea of cookie-cutter EVs, iQube’s evolved styling screams confident evolution.
